Facilities Ticket — Cleaning Crew Access, Brindle Annex

For new starters handling evening lock-up: the Sorano Cleaning crew arrives nightly at 21:30 via the annex side door. Check their rota sheet, note arrival in the log, and ensure the storeroom is relocked afterward. To let them through the side door, enter the access code below.

badge for yaweg-hafog: bdg-GX-6

Ticket FM-2281: The summer intern cohort for Brightlea Analytics arrives Monday at the Fennel Street office. Twelve interns total, starting in the third-floor open area. Team assistants should collect welcome packs from the mailroom before 9:00 and escort interns from the lobby. Temporary badges are pre-printed; desks are labelled. Until individual badges are activated, escorts should use the shared door-pass code below.

door code, bageg-bajof: bdg-IU-0

## Step 4: Patch the image cache

Quick context for support: the Snapcrate thumbnail service had a slow memory leak — cached image buffers weren't released after resize failures, so pods would balloon over a few days and get OOM-killed around 3 a.m. The 2.9 release fixes the leak and adds an eviction ceiling, but you must restart each pod after applying the new settings. Apply the updated cache configuration shown below.

settings of fawip-yadug:
[druath]
port = 3000
region = north-4
host = druath.qirvanworks.corp
timeout_ms = 1500
retries = 1

# Break-Glass: Catalog Cache Invalidation

Scope: the Pinrow product catalog at Veldstone Retail. If stale prices persist after a purge and the Hollowmere invalidation queue is wedged, use break-glass to flush the edge tier directly. Contractors: get verbal sign-off from the catalog lead first. Steps: open the Hollowmere admin shell, select emergency-flush, confirm the tenant, and run it once — repeated flushes thrash the origin. Access is logged and expires after 20 minutes. Unseal the admin shell with the passphrase below.

recovery phrase for kahop-tajog: istix-casvan